According to PSU Tier list the Evga G2 750w (superflower) is in Tier One but on Amazon there are a lot of bad reviews, PSU died to a lot of people after first few days and even damaged HDD's and parts in the process, it seems that the SATA cables are of very bad build quality.

How reliable is the PSU tier list, how can tier one PSU have soo many bad reviews on Amazon?

I'm asking because i can get second hand 1 year old Evga g2 750w for 50% of retail price, should i go for it?

Also, people with crap experiences are more likely to write a review. You could probably quadruple the number of good units. If not more.
Talked to a retailer, he said their RMA rate was about 0.5 percent out of 1500 units.
